1) Namecheap
Namecheap is one of the most popular hosting companies in the industry with a large variety of plans to choose from. They offer shared, reseller, and dedicated hosting packages. Namecheap has been in business since 2000 and has grown to be a major player in the hosting industry with over 1 million domains under their management. With 24/7 customer support, you can rest assured that your site will be taken care of even when you're not around.

4) Inmotion Hosting
Inmotion hosting is a great choice if you're looking for cheap hosting and have a small budget. Inmotion offers shared hosting with support and features that are just as good as many other more expensive hosts, but at a fraction of the price. In Motion's focus on customer service is what sets them apart from other providers. They offer live chat, phone, and email support 24/7, as well as an online knowledgebase that answers your most popular questions. Plus, their knowledgeable customer service agents can help you out even if you're not sure about the exact problem you're experiencing—they'll be able to guide you through diagnosing the issue until it's fixed.
